Ashaiman’s main market is destroyed by fire; 40 shops perish.

On Sunday, September 10, 2023, a massive fire decimated the Ashaiman Main Market, necessitating the valiant efforts of firefighters from multiple stations to put it out.

For a laborious two hours and thirty minutes, firefighters from the Motorway, Tema Metro, and Tema Industrial Area Fire Stations, as well as two water tankers from Tema RHQ and GHAPOHA Fire Department, battled the blaze.

About 40 shops and stalls, including metal containers used to sell millet, maize, and numerous other goods, were completely destroyed by the ferocious fire.

Despite the fire’s fury, the firefighters managed to contain, contain, and put out the flames in time to save an unspecified number of stores and goods.

There were no casualties attributed to the incident.

Although officials have already taken precautions, the precise origin of the fire is still being investigated.

To avoid any potential risks of electrocution to onlookers, the Electricity Company of Ghana has severed the electrical service lines that were damaged during the incident.
